Output e900ee68b5531e74cfc312a7fd83a27aa62151fbb7fbc43f0c60b652375bb5df:6

value
86285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950103f31bd31e0345fe600b7aa6f690ec0c9493 OP_EQUAL
address
3FGspgNhbXKeBshiKJK8PBkcFY9MUUsh2G
transaction
e900ee68b5531e74cfc312a7fd83a27aa62151fbb7fbc43f0c60b652375bb5df
spent
true